Sha256: 1d1349d0e1c651b4017c63d7a08dc904540914a82d1ae11e29e5620e86a0c2f8
Contents?: true
Size: 963 Bytes
Versions: 42
Compression:
Stored size: 963 Bytes
Contents
import React from 'react'; import PropTypes from 'prop-types'; import { Grid, TextContent, Text, TextVariants, Flex, FlexItem } from '@patternfly/react-core'; const WizardHeader = ({ title, description, }) => ( <Grid style={{ gridGap: '24px' }}> {title && <TextContent> <Text ouiaId="wizard-header-text" component={TextVariants.h2}>{title}</Text> </TextContent>} {description && <TextContent> <Flex flex={{ default: 'inlineFlex' }}> <FlexItem> <TextContent> {description} </TextContent> </FlexItem> </Flex> </TextContent>} </Grid> ); WizardHeader.propTypes = { title: PropTypes.oneOfType([ PropTypes.node, PropTypes.string, ]), description: PropTypes.oneOfType([ PropTypes.node, PropTypes.string, ]), }; WizardHeader.defaultProps = { title: undefined, description: undefined, }; export default WizardHeader;
Version data entries
42 entries across 42 versions & 1 rubygems